General Description
3-Bromo-5-cyclopropyl-1,2,4-oxadiazole is a specific chemical compound that belongs to the class of organic compounds known as oxadiazoles. More specifically, it is a member of the 1,2,4-oxadiazoles, which are aromatic heterocyclic compounds containing a 1,2,4-oxadiazole ring. This particular compound is characterized by its structural features which include a bromine atom and a cyclopropyl group attached to the oxadiazole ring. It is used primarily in chemical synthesis because of its unique reactivity due to the presence of the oxadiazole ring. Its molecular formula is C5H5BrN2O, indicating it contains carbon, hydrogen, bromine, nitrogen, and oxygen atoms.

A Novel Synthesis of 3-Bromo-1,2,4-oxadiazoles
Humphrey, Guy R.,Wright, Stanley H.B.
, p. 23 - 24 (2007/10/02)
A novel synthesis of 3-bromo-1,2,4-oxadiazoles by 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ition between bromocyanogen oxide and alkyl and aryl nitriles is described.
